💪 Lateral Raise
Raise dumbbells out to the sides to shoulder height. Builds wide, capped shoulders.

How to do the Lateral Raise
- Stand with feet shoulder-width apart, dumbbells at your sides
- With a slight bend in your elbows, raise the dumbbells out to the sides
- Lift until your arms are parallel to the floor (shoulder height)
- Pause briefly at the top
- Lower slowly back to the starting position
Form tips
- Lead with your elbows, not your hands
- Don't swing or use momentum — control the weight
- Keep a slight bend in elbows throughout
- Thumbs slightly tilted down (like pouring water) for better activation
Muscles worked
Lateral Deltoid, Upper Trapezius
When to be cautious
- Shoulder impingement
- Rotator cuff injury
